Hot Wheels DMC DeLorean Factory Fresh Shopee Malaysia 64130

Hot Wheels DMC DeLorean Factory Fresh Shopee Malaysia

Related pictures for Hot Wheels DMC DeLorean Factory Fresh Shopee Malaysia